description |
This paper outlines the historical origins and use of jiggers in the squid fishery. The practice is apparently universal and dates from the mid-8th century in Japan. The evolution of the jigger used in the Newfoundland/Canadian fishery, the several forms it has taken, its use, as well as other methods of capturing numerous species of teuthoids are briefly discussed. |
